Monotonous Driving Environment along Highway and Driver Behaviour in Malaysia: A Review

Summary
This review paper addresses the critical road safety issue of driver hypovigilance and fatigue caused by monotonous highway environments in Malaysia. Motivated by the country’s high motorization rates, with over 25 million registered vehicles and a dense road network, and persistent high crash fatalities (6,708 deaths in 2015), the study investigates how the lack of visual and sensory stimuli in straight, long highway stretches leads to driver disengagement, drowsiness, and crashes. The authors argue that while vehicle and road design advancements have increased comfort, they have simultaneously increased task under-loading and monotony, necessitating a critical review of existing countermeasures and local research. The methodology involved an extensive literature review of Malaysian research published between 1990 and 2017. The authors utilized Google Scholar, ScienceDirect, ResearchGate, and databases from the Malaysian Institute of Road Safety Research (MIROS) and the Ministry of Transport (MOT). The search strategy targeted keywords related to monotonous driving environments, driver fatigue, and highway landscaping, yielding 39 relevant publications. These were categorized into direct driver vigilance research (24 studies), literature reviews on driver performance (10 studies), literature reviews on highways (3 studies), and direct research on highway landscaping (3 studies). The direct vigilance studies included 10 driving simulator experiments, 10 subjective surveys, and 4 real-world observations. Key findings indicate that monotony significantly reduces cerebral activation, leading to hypovigilance, which accounts for 20% of crash fatalities in Malaysia. The review highlights that current countermeasures, such as road geometry manipulation, landscaping, signage, and in-vehicle alert devices, are largely ad hoc and short-term. Specific Malaysian studies cited in the review demonstrate that monotonous environments lead to higher driving stress and fatigue compared to complex environments, and that physiological measures like ECG and EEG are effective for detecting drowsiness, with ECG showing 98% accuracy in hypovigilance detection. Additionally, research on bus drivers revealed that fatigue occurs after two hours of driving, and that banning wee-hour express bus operations would likely shift traffic to private vehicles, increasing crash risks rather than reducing them. The review also notes that road geometry variables, such as horizontal curvature and paved shoulder width, are associated with more severe crashes, while access points and medians reduce crash probability. The significance of this paper lies in its identification of a gap in robust research regarding the improvement and appraisal of countermeasures for highway monotony. Despite the volume of existing studies, the authors conclude that there is a need for the development of specific monotony effect indices and more effective, long-term strategies to combat driver fatigue. The review underscores that while the road environment is the most critical factor in mitigating monotony, no single efficient countermeasure currently exists, and drivers must remain vigilant and take breaks when experiencing drowsiness. This synthesis provides a foundation for future policy and engineering interventions aimed at enhancing road safety in highly motorized contexts.
